    • Well, when you have a sample in the machiniste there is a output and the I use a splitter to make two signals, the eq I use to boost wanted frequenties that make the sound better (like for example a kick sample that needs more punch), if I do it for the higher and lower I get two signals in my mixer and there I adjust the volumes/panning for a good endresult..

    • I have no idea what that means, but it sounds really cool

    • They are to colour the sounds of the drumsamles, I split them and use one to accentuate the high end and the other for the low end, later I make a mix or add efects like panning delay or reverb, this is something for the mix fase when most of the music is done because it can cause lagging:~)
